Bruce Bochy says he hasn’t heard anything about Lincecum trade; comments on managing All-Star Game

San Francisco Giants manager Bruce Bochy joined the show to talk about the All-Star Game and more.

Dan asked Bochy about the possibility Tim Lincecum will be dealt. “I haven’t heard anything about trades,” Bochy said. “He’s so well loved in the Bay Area and all of us.n …. We’re thin in our rotation. We can’t afford to lose him. … We still believe we’re in this.”

Bochy had a lot of praise for Mariano Rivera. “He’s such a humble man,” Bochy said. “Just a great person.”

Bochy tried to explain why it’s so hard to hit Rivera. “It’s got such a late break to it,” Bochy said. “It looks like a fastball and it has that late break at the end.”

Dan asked Bochy who had the best pitches that he’s ever seen. He immediately talked about Nolan Ryan’s fastball, and Trevor Hoffman and J.R. Richard for his slider. “You ask any hitter in the National League,” Bochy said of Richard. “They didn’t want anything to do with this guy.”

Bochy also explained his decision on not adding Yasiel Puig to the roster. He said that it came down to how long he played.
